Our Mission Statement
The Poetic Bandits are a group of active members on AllPoetry who are dedicated to improving their skills as a writer as well as helping others to improve. Our focus is not only to grow within our group, but to also help the entire AllPoetry community. We shall not let our own beliefs get in the way when critiquing another's poem and will not bash another poet because their beliefs are not our own. We see writing as an art and treat it likewise. We will be honest yet encouraging when commenting and shall only give constructive criticism, never direct condemnation. Group members treat each other with the same respect and kindness as they would like to receive in return. We will not tolerate unlawfulness inside or outside the group. We will abide by and uphold the rules of AllPoetry written by the administration. We continuously strive to improve our group with new ideas to make it a fun, more interactive group.

Bandits We Be
by © Dee Garner March 14, 2007
Out of the darkness they came
With gusto and one common thought
So many well meaning bandits
Fear and apprehension ‘twas naught
They sprang from the pages
Of mirth and mystical rhyme
Just to spread cheer and love
From out of the pages of time
The breeze carried their song
To each target of their attack
Yet each was caught by surprise
And was duly taken aback
So come all ye merry poets
Poetic Bandits though we be
We’ll only steal a moment or two
Then give it back whole heartedly
